Why This Hook Works

This hook employs a pattern interrupt by challenging a widely accepted belief—'follow your passion'—and immediately presents a counter-narrative. This technique provokes curiosity and stirs emotions, compelling the audience to reconsider their assumptions. By stating that this popular advice is 'terrible,' the speaker not only grabs attention but also establishes authority as a creative coach who has witnessed the negative consequences of this myth. This creates an emotional connection with viewers who may have felt disillusioned by conventional wisdom, enhancing their engagement with the content.

Furthermore, the hook taps into the curiosity gap by suggesting that there is a 'better strategy that actually works.' This phrase piques interest, as it promises valuable insights that contrast with the common rhetoric. It makes the audience wonder what this alternative strategy could be, driving them to watch the video to fill that gap. The identity trigger is also at play here, particularly for creatives who may identify with the struggle of following their passion without seeing results, making them eager to find a solution that resonates with their experiences.

By combining these psychological techniques, the hook not only captivates attention but also fosters a sense of community among viewers who might feel isolated in their creative journeys, encouraging them to engage with the content and explore the proposed alternative strategy.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why does this hook stop the scroll?

It challenges a common belief, making viewers curious about the alternative.

Which platforms is this best for?

Best for TikTok due to its quick, engaging format that thrives on edgy content.

How do I adapt this to my niche?

Identify a common misconception in your niche and propose a compelling alternative.

What makes this hook better than generic openers?

It confronts the audience with a controversial statement that provokes thought and discussion.
